Nissan Motor Company Ltd, usually shortened to Nissan, is a Japanese international automobile manufacturer headquartered in Nishi-ku, Yokohama, Japan.Since 1999, Nissan has been part of the Renault-Nissan Alliance, a partnership between Nissan as well as French automaker Renault. As of 2013, Renault holds a 43. 4% voting stake within Nissan, while Nissan holds a new 15% non-voting stake within Renault. Carlos Ghosn serves seeing that CEO of both corporations.A Nissan Dealership throughout Patiala, IndiaNissan Motor sells its cars underneath the Nissan, Infiniti, and Datsun brands along with in-house performance tuning products labelled Nismo.Nissan was the sixth largest automaker on the planet behind Toyota, General Motors, Volkswagen Group, Hyundai Motor Group, and Ford in 2013. Taken together, the Renault-Nissan Alliance are the world’s fourth largest automaker. Nissan is the leading Japanese brand in Cina, Russia and Mexico.Masujiro Hashimoto founded this Kwaishinsha Motor Car Operates in 1911. In 1914, the company produced their first car, called DAT.

The modern car's name was an acronym of the company's investors' surnames:Kenjiro Den (田 健次郎 Family room Kenjirō?)Rokuro Aoyama (青山 禄郎 Aoyama Rokurō?)Meitaro Takeuchi (竹内 明太郎 Takeuchi Meitarō?)It was renamed to Kwaishinsha Motorcar Co., Ltd. in 1918, and again to DAT Jidosha & Corp., Ltd. (DAT Motorcar Co.) in 1925. DAT Motors built trucks beyond just the DAT and Datsun voyager cars. The vast majority regarding its output were trucks, due to an pretty much non- existent consumer current market for passenger cars back then. Beginning in 1918, the first DAT trucks were produced for that military market. At the same period, Jitsuyo Jidosha Co., Ltd. produced small trucks utilizing parts, and materials imported from the us.In 1926 the Tokyo-based DAT Motors merged while using Osaka-based Jitsuyo Jidosha Co., Ltd. (実用自 動車製造株式会社 Jitsuyō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?) a. k. a. Jitsuyo Jidosha Seizo (established 1919 being a Kubota subsidiary) being DAT Jidosha Seizo Company., Ltd Automobile Manufacturing Company., Ltd. (ダット自動車製造株式会社 DAT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?) in Osaka until finally 1932. From 1923 to 1925, the company produced light vehicles under the name involving Lila.In 1931, DAT came out with a new smaller car, the first "Datson", meaning "Son of DAT". Later in 1933 immediately after Nissan took control associated with DAT Motors, the last syllable connected with Datson was changed to help "sun", because "son" also means "loss" (損) within Japanese, hence the name "Datsun" (ダットサン Dattosan?).In 1933, the company name seemed to be Nipponized to Jidosha-Seizo Company., Ltd. (自動車製造株式会社 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?, "Automobile Manufacturing Co., Ltd. ") and was moved to Yokohama.

Nissan name first used in 1930sIn 1928, Yoshisuke Aikawa founded the particular holding company Nihon Sangyo (日本産業 Japan Industries or Nihon Sectors). The name 'Nissan' originated during the 1930s as an abbreviation[14] officially used on the Tokyo stock market place for Nihon Sangyo. This company was your famous Nissan "Zaibatsu" which included Tobata Casting and Hitachi. At this time Nissan controlled foundries and auto areas businesses, but Aikawa did not enter automobile manufacturing until 1933.The zaibatsu eventually grew to incorporate 74 firms, and became the fourth-largest with Japan during World Conflict II.In 1931, DAT Jidosha Seizo became affiliated with Tobata Casting, and was merged directly into Tobata Casting in 1933. As Tobata Casting was a Nissan company, this was the start of Nissan's automobile production.

Nissan Motor founded in 1934In 1934, Aikawa separated the expanded automobile parts division involving Tobata Casting and incorporated it as being a new subsidiary, which he named Nissan Generator Co., Ltd. (日産自動車 Nissan Jidōsha?). The shareholders of the new company however were not considering the prospects of the car in Japan, so Aikawa bought out every one of the Tobata Casting shareholders (employing capital from Nihon Sectors) in June 1934. At this time, Nissan Motor effectively started to be owned by Nihon Sangyo in addition to Hitachi.In 1935, construction of its Yokohama plant was completed. 44 Datsuns were transported to Asia, Central and South The usa. In 1935, the first car manufactured by a built-in assembly system rolled journey line at the Yokohama seed. Nissan built trucks, airplanes, and engines for the japanese military. In 1937, the company's main plant was moved towards the occupied Manchuria, and named Manchuria Major Industries Developing Co.In 1940, first knockdown kits were being shipped to Dowa Jidosha Kogyo (Dowa Automobile), one of MHID’s corporations, for assembly. In 1944, the head office ended up being moved to Nihonbashi, Tokyo, and the company label was changed to Nissan Hefty Industries, Ltd., which the company maintained through 1949.
